TIME2026-04-02 16:56:53

蝙蝠 接码网[V752]

搜索
热点
新闻分类
友情链接
首页 > 资讯 > 登录时如何获取验证码呢
资讯
登录时如何获取验证码呢
2025-08-18IP属地 美国0

获取验证码通常是在用户登录或注册时的一种常见流程,用于验证用户的身份并确保他们不是机器人或恶意用户。验证码可以通过多种方式发送给用户,包括短信、邮件、语音电话或直接显示在页面上。以下是获取验证码的一般步骤。

1. 用户输入信息:

用户在登录或注册页面输入他们的手机号、邮箱或其他唯一标识符。

2. 提交请求:

用户点击获取验证码按钮,提交请求,系统开始处理用户的请求。

3. 系统处理:

系统验证用户输入的信息是否有效(手机号是否格式正确),然后开始生成验证码。

4. 发送验证码:

登录时如何获取验证码呢

系统通过以下方式之一将验证码发送到用户:

短信:系统通过短信网关发送验证码到用户输入的手机号码。

邮件:系统通过邮件的方式将验证码发送到用户输入的邮箱地址。

语音电话:系统自动拨打用户的电话并播放验证码。

应用通知:如果用户已经安装了相关的应用,可以通过应用通知的方式发送验证码。

5. 验证接收:

用户收到验证码后,需要在登录或注册页面输入正确的验证码,系统验证用户输入的验证码是否正确。

6. 登录/注册流程继续:

如果验证码正确,用户可以完成登录或注册流程,如果验证码错误或过期,系统通常会要求用户重新发送验证码。

技术实现细节:

在后端,你需要一个服务来处理用户的请求,生成和发送验证码,你可能需要使用第三方服务(如短信网关服务)来发送短信验证码,在前端,你需要确保用户输入的信息格式正确,并处理用户提交的请求,你还需要确保验证码的安全性和时效性。

注意事项:

安全性:确保验证码的生成和传输是安全的,防止被恶意用户拦截或篡改。

时效性:设置一个合理的验证码有效期,通常为几分钟到几十分钟。

用户体验:尽量简化流程,确保用户在短时间内能收到并验证验证码。

多途径验证:除了短信验证码,还可以提供其他验证方式(如邮件、语音等)以提高系统的可用性和灵活性。

是一个基本的流程概述,具体的实现可能会根据你的应用需求和使用的技术栈有所不同。